Holden's Perception of Others in Catcher in the Rye J.D. Salinger's novel Catcher in the Rye revolves around Holden's encounters with other people. He divides all people into two different categories, the "phonies" and the authentics. Holden refers to a "phony" as someone who discriminates against others, is a hypocrite, or has manifestations of conformity. A person's age, gender, and occupation, play a key role in how Holden interacts with them. Holden shows a particular liking towards children over adults.
Salem Witchcraft Witchcraft accusations and trials in 1692 rocked the colony of Salem Massachusetts. There are some different views that are offered concerning why neighbors decided to condemn the people around them as witches and why they did what they did to one another. Carol Karlsen in her book The Devil in the Shape of a Woman and Bernard Rosenthal in Salem Story give several factors, ranging from woman hunting to shear malice, that help explain why the Salem trials took place and why they reached the magnitude that they did.
Gunsmoke and the OldWest Lawman The classic radio show "Gunsmoke," was the epitome of old west drama. Set in the frontier town of Dodge City during the 1870's and 80's, Gunsmoke followed U.S. Marshall Matt Dillon through his many adventures. Matt Dillon was the embodiment of the stereotypical lawman of the old west. He is set apart as an old west hero by his independence, selfreliance, and sense of justice. Matt Dillon works as an independent lawman. In our modern times we are used to policemen who work interdependently of a greater police force.
